Turkey, Ottoman Empire. An Ottoman War Medal, by B.B. & Co. Auction (Spomenica srpsko-bugarskog rata)(Harp Madalyas). Constructed of silvered tombak with enamels, consisting of a five pointed star completing in ball finials, the obverse with red enameled arms demonstrating a classic strawberry seed style pattern, overlaid by a raised and silvered crescent, surrounding a silvered Tughra of Sultan Mehmed V above an Islamic calendar date of 1333 (AD 1915), the reverse affixed with a two piece suspension apparatus consisting of a rectangular base plate
